Antonio

Antonio is a sea pirate (although he refutes that label) who rescued Sebastian from the Shipwreck that saw Viola washed up on Illyria. After three months at sea, they too arrive on Illyria’s shore. During their three months together, alone, on a boat, they developed a very close bond. Whether they are simply close friends or lovers though (although both could be true) is up for debate, as it is never made explicate. Either way, their relationship is significant in the way that it dramatises male connection. It is interesting that neither Antonio nor Sebastian’s love for one another is characterised as madness, as so much love within the play is. It is only when they find themselves in situations where their love (or someone else’s love for them, in Sebastian’s case) is unrequited that they join the chaos, suggesting that only unrequited love is wrong, while love that is shared is good.
